Basic facts about this digital color

#011F28 falls into the Cyan Color Family — Full Saturation, Very Dark brightness. Its exact recipe is rgb(1, 31, 40) — 0.4% red, 12.2% green, 15.7% blue — and for print it converts to CMYK 15 / 4 / 0 / 84. Curious how these numbers work? Read our RGB color codes guide.

The color #011F28 reads as a pure, full-strength aqua cyan and keeps to the darkest edge of the palette. Expect to see shades like this in dark UI themes, backgrounds and dramatic accents. In The Official Register of Color Names it is a near neighbor of Very Deep Cyan (#001D1D). Slightly further away sit Daintree (#012731) and Ornella Blue (#021224).

Technically, the mix leans on its blue channel (rgb(1, 31, 40)), which gives #011F28 its character. Accessibility-wise, white text works best on #011F28: 17.1:1 contrast (passing WCAG AAA) versus 1.2:1 for black. On paper it relies strongly on black ink (K:84), so proof dark layouts before a large print run. #011F28 color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Complementary color schemes

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Split complementary color scheme

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Analogous color scheme

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Triadic color scheme

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Tetradic color scheme

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
